Why each option

Business outcome-based selling presents financial challenges due to competing stakeholder goals, distributed financial resources, and lengthy IT adoption cycles.

ACompeting stakeholder goals and expectations.Correct

Competing stakeholder goals make it difficult to establish a unified financial outcome to pursue, leading to budget conflicts and challenges in allocating funds effectively for a shared business result.

BDifficulty to determine external value.

Difficulty to determine external value primarily relates to market valuation or competitive positioning, which is not a direct internal financial challenge for implementing outcome-based selling initiatives.

CFinancial resources are distributed across functional areas.Correct

When financial resources are scattered across different functional areas, it impedes the ability to centralize investment for cross-functional initiatives required by outcome-based solutions, thus creating funding obstacles.

DCompetitive analysis is often incomplete.

Incomplete competitive analysis is a strategic or market intelligence issue, not an intrinsic financial challenge related to the allocation or management of an organization's financial resources for outcome-based selling.

EIT adoption and implementation may have long business cycles.Correct

Long business cycles for IT adoption and implementation defer the realization of financial benefits, presenting a cash flow and ROI justification challenge for businesses investing in outcome-based solutions.
